"Godan" is Premchand's most celebrated novel, and it tells the story of Hori, a poor farmer in a small village in northern India. The novel revolves around Hori's struggles to make ends meet, his desire to own a cow (which is considered a symbol of prosperity and dignity in rural India), and his ultimate tragedy. For students, professors, and casual readers alike, the quest for a reliable, accessible PDF of Munshi Premchand’s magnum opus, Godan (The Gift of a Cow), is a perennial task. Published in 1936, this novel is not just a story; it is a sociological document that captures the agony and exploitation of the Indian peasantry under feudalism and colonialism.
